WebDec 14, 2024 · Factitious disorder imposed on another (previously called Munchausen syndrome by proxy) is when someone falsely claims that another person has physical or … WebThe appointment of a proxy is sometimes called a proxy directive or durable power of attorney. The patient names a proxy decision maker when he or she is competent. In other cases, the physician may appoint a proxy, or the court may appoint a legal guardian who acts on behalf of an incompetent person. Health care proxy and Medicare: Rules, legalities, and more

WebA Health Care Proxy is the primary decision maker in the stead of incompetent patients facing life and death circumstances. They make tough choices concerning treatment options, insurance benefits and, of course, … WebJun 27, 2024 · There are times when a person needs to sign a document and have it notarized immediately, but the person is unable to write at all. Some states allow signers who can’t write to use an option called signature by proxy, where someone else present signs on behalf of the person who is unable to write.

WebIn current practice, men who are dead may be sealed by proxy to all of the women to whom they were legally married while alive. Recent changes in church policy also allow women to be sealed to multiple men, but only after both she and her husbands are dead. WebApr 8, 2024 · According to Dictionary, the word proxy is a noun that refers to something that stands in for something else. Therefore, a proxy can be someone who acts on behalf of someone else. The word proxy can also refer to a written agreement authorizing someone to act or vote on their behalf. The pronunciation of proxy is ˈprɒksi. Jennifer will hold my … WebMay 21, 2024 · Proxy servers act as a firewall and web filter, provide shared network connections, and cache data to speed up common requests. A good proxy server keeps users and the internal network protected from the bad stuff that lives out in the wild internet. Lastly, proxy servers can provide a high level of privacy.

WebOpen Proxy Meaning Proxy servers act as an intermediary between a user’s computer and their server, enabling users to hide their location and access websites that may be blocked by their internet provider. An open proxy is a server configured to allow anyone to use it.
